The farming-pastoral zone of northern China plays a dual role in ecological conditions and production and occupies an important position in the national economy. In this paper, the methodology of system engineering is introduced to construct and optimize an eco-productive paradigm system for the typical areas of the farming-pastoral zone. The system was constructed in the following steps: (1) design the framework of the paradigm system based on the data of physical site characteristics, biocommunities, production and economy, social culture and historical changes; (2) analyze the vegetation patterns, the interactions between vegetation and environmental factors (natural, social, economic, etc.) and the contributions of vegetation to the area, including the synthesis of the existing researches; and (3) provide the spatial arrangements of ecosystems and planning of each area, raise a comprehensive indicators of evaluation, evaluate the feasibility and soundness, and determine the optimum eco-productive paradigms for policy-makers which were land-use patterns within the threshold of ecological conservation. Three primitive paradigms of Maowusu (Mu Us) Ssandy Land, Loess Plateau and Huailai Basin in the farming-pastoral zone of northern China were proposed according to this paradigm system. 展开更多

"Internet +" eco-production and eco-tourism carried out by agricultural enterprises is one of ways to increase income.Urban economic development index evaluation value(u_1),agricultural enterprises' eco-production and eco-tourism index evaluation value(u_2) and Internet popularity index evaluation value(u_3) constitute the ternary coupling system.The ternary coupling coordination degree(D_3) combined with u_2 can be used to judge whether the agricultural enterprises practise eco-production and eco-tourism mode.When u_2≥ 0.5000,D3≥0.6000,the autonomous mode for agricultural enterprises can be used; when 0.4000≤u_2< 0.5000,0.5000≤D_3< 0.6000,the mode of cooperation with travel agency can be used; when 0.3000 ≤u_2< 0.4000,0.4000 ≤D < 0.5000,the tourism business transfer mode can be used; when u_2< 0.3000,D < 0.4000,the tourism business should not be carried out.All the above four modes require "Internet +". 展开更多

Case Based Reasoning(CBR)is one of the artificial intelligent methodologies that is widely used in problem solving by reusing the most similar previous experiences stored in the library.A framework of ECO-CBR for Life Cycle Assessment data collection has been used and the process was carried out using SolidWorks program.The practicality of the tool has been validated using case study,which then provides solution.The output enable researchers to determine forecast error and forecast accuracy,by valuing the calculation from Total Carbon Footprint,Energy Consumption,Air Acidification,and Water Eutrophication.ECO-CBR is able to assist designers in product design.Due to the limitation of environmental impact consideration in product sustainability,there is a demand to propose a tool that can assist designers to reduce environmental impact of product design at early stage.The model works as an essential guideline to lessen repeated mistakes in the product development process and help designers measure the risks before concluding ideal decisions.Minor errors that occur through the study showed that ECO-CBR is reliable to be implemented in order to find a better solution. 展开更多

The article uses a case study approach to investigate the mechanisms of ecological product value realization,and influencing factors.Specifically,we use a case analysis framework based on the“economy-societynatural ecology”perspective to analyze and compare the three batches of“Typical Cases of Ecological ProductValue Realization”released by the Ministry of Natural Resources.We find:First,different modes of ecologicalproduct value realization exist.Different resource endowments,and institutional and environmental factors affectthe selection of the value realization modes.Second,certain obstacles also exist for realizing ecological productvalue,which are mainly reflected in the fact that the articulation of the individual,society,and government is not yetsufficiently close.Third,to promote the development of regional eco-products’mode and value conversion,the implementing party needs to guide the synergy between individual concepts,social participation,and governmentaltop-level design;rationally arrange the allocation of resource elements;mitigate elemental constraints;and proposeeffective technical means and optimization strategies according to the actual situation. 展开更多

The green environmental laws and regulations are legislated, implemented, and enforced in many countries and economic regions. The provision of green products and services are the fast growing trend in global consumer markets. Therefore, introducing new products with environmental considerations becomes critical for global brand manufacturers. This research depicts an integrated and intelligent eco- and inno-product design methodology to support environmental friendly green product development. The methodology adopts approaches, such as life cycle assessment (LCA), quality function deploymnet for environement (QFDE), theory of inventive problem solving (TRIZ) and back-propagation network (BPN) to achieve eco- and inno-design objectives. LCA evaluates and compares the environmental impacts of production. QFDE transforms high-level concerns of environment into design requirements. When there are many historical QFDE data, the BPN prediction model is trained and deployed to automate the specifications of green design improvement. TRIZ is to support the creation of innovative product design ideas effectively and efficiently during the concept design stage. Finally, this paper presents two eco-design cases of power adaptor to demonstrate the proposed methodology. 展开更多

Empowering the value realization of ecological products with a digital economy is an important path for achieving the transformation of“two mountains”and the construction of ecological civilization.Based on the panel data of 30 provinces in China from 2011 to 2022,a fixed-effects model was used to empirically test the impact,heterogeneity and mechanism of the effects of the digital economy on the value realization of ecological products.This analysis revealed three key findings.(1)The digital economy has a significant driving effect on improving the ability to realize the value of ecological products,and this effect is still applicable in a variety of robustness tests such as shrinking the years,replacing explanatory variables,and endogeneity tests.(2)The rise of the digital economy affects the value realization of ecological products to different degrees in different regions,especially in the eastern region,while the effect in the central region is not obvious.(3)The analysis of mechanistic variables indicated that the digital economy has an impact on the value realization of ecological products through the development of green finance and government revenue.Therefore,the government should design differentiated and multi-level support policies for the realization of ecological product value according to the heterogeneity of natural resources,ecological potential and the levels of digital economy development in different regions,and it should strengthen the control of non-environmental protection behaviors of the enterprises.Enterprises should accelerate the digital transformation of the entire production,distribution,circulation and consumption chain of ecological products,and actively develop financial products and services that meet the characteristics and needs of ecological products. 展开更多
